Job description

An excellent new job opportunity has arisen for a dedicated CAMHS Therapist to work in an exceptional mental health service based in the Witham area. You will be working for one of UK's leading health care providers

This is an exceptional mental health service which providing high standards of treatment for a various range of mental health difficulties

As the CAMHS Therapist your key duties include:

  • Deliver evidence-based therapeutic interventions for children, young people, and their families to support positive mental health and emotional wellbeing
  • Lead family-focused therapy sessions aimed at enhancing relationships, improving communication, and addressing interpersonal difficulties within the family unit
  • Work in partnership with the wider multidisciplinary CAMHS team to assess needs, develop tailored treatment plans, and review progress throughout care
  • Conduct comprehensive assessments of family relationships and environmental influences to identify factors impacting a young person's psychological wellbeing
  • Provide practical advice, psychoeducation, and emotional support to families, helping them develop effective coping strategies and build resilience during the young person's inpatient admission

The following skills and experience would be preferred and beneficial for the role:

  • Comprehensive knowledge of family systems theory, supported by expertise in evidence-based counselling and therapeutic interventions
  • Demonstrated success in providing therapeutic support to children, young people, and families across clinical, community, or social care settings
  • Highly developed ver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to build trusting relationships and engage effectively with individuals from diverse backgrounds
  • Experience working collaboratively with professionals from a range of disciplines, contributing to coordinated, person-centred mental health and wellbeing services
  • Strong analytical and critical thinking abilities, combined with emotional resilience and a commitment to continuous professional learning, enabling responsive, high-quality support that reflects current best practice in family therapy

The successful CAMHS Therapist will receive an excellent salary of £40,000 - £42,000 per annum - Pay frequency is monthly. This exciting position is permanent full time role working 37.5 hours a week. In return for your hard work and commitment you will receive the following generous benefits:
